How to Buy a Farm With No Money is a guide to working with the USDA to purchase land and home for farming. It covers such topics as how to get started in farming, filing a DBA, taxes, growing your farming operation, cultivating community, and includes tips and suggestions for involving the whole family. This resource provides detailed steps for reaching out to your local USDA Service Center, with an overview of the different loans and the process that applicants can expect to face, as well as strategies and advice on crowdfunding. It is my hope that this book will help other beginning farmers find their way to farm-ownership?especially the women.
